The Benefits of Acton Double Glazing

Double glazing is a kind of window that has two panes of glass separated by a gas, like argon or air that creates an insulation barrier. It also helps to regulate the temperature of your home, and also reduces energy bills.

Many people are installing these windows because they offer a variety of benefits, including lower cost of energy and better temperature control. They also help protect your furniture, decor, and other materials from heat loss.

Energy Efficiency

Energy efficient windows can help reduce the cost of heating your home and carbon footprint. This is especially important in the winter months, as windows let in heat. This makes it more difficult to keep your home warm, as well as increase the cost of energy.

New double glazed windows have airtight seals to prevent heat from getting through the window. To protect the interior, they are also filled with the gas argon. These windows are extremely energy-efficient and can help you save lots of money in the long-term.

Condensation Control

Condensation on the inside of double glazed windows can be a problem that homeowners find difficult to cope with. This is especially prevalent in winter , when cold air gets trapped inside the home. It causes steam to form on the exterior of the double glazing panes.

This condensation is typically caused by the seal between the two glass panes within an IGU. (IGU) and is typically the first indication that the IGU is not working properly or needs replacing. The IGU includes spacer (metal strip or polymer strip) that has desiccant that absorbs moisture. The desiccant absorbs any moisture that gets into the space between the two glass panes, and this is when condensation starts to form on the surface of the IGU.

It is important to make sure that your home has the proper humidity and ventilation to prevent condensation from forming. This can be done by opening the windows as you go about your daily routine, and making sure that that the vents on your trickle are open when you're away from home.

Additionally in addition, if you own home plants that produce huge amounts of water vapour then it's important to ensure they are moved outdoors so that they don't leak into your home and causing moisture to form on surfaces they are placed on. Having the appropriate amount of heating within your home will help to keep your property at a comfortable temperature and therefore reduce the risk of surface condensation occurring.
